# Python遍历时间
在Python编程语言中,我们经常需要处理时间数据。无论是计算日期之间的差值,生成时间序列,还是对时间进行格式化,Python都提供了简单而强大的工具。本文将介绍如何使用Python遍历时间,并提供一些常用的示例代码。
## 1. datetime模块
Python的datetime模块提供了处理日期和时间的类和方法。我们可以使用datetime类来表示一个特定的日
原创
2023-09-15 18:44:57
185阅读
# 遍历时间 Java 实现
## 概述
在Java中,遍历时间是指按照一定的规律逐个遍历时间序列,例如按天、按小时、按月等。本文将介绍如何使用Java实现遍历时间的方法以及具体的代码实现。
## 流程图
```mermaid
flowchart TD
A(开始) --> B(设定起始时间和结束时间)
B --> C(初始化日历对象)
C --> D(遍历时间)
原创
2024-01-09 04:19:32
79阅读
在这篇博文中,我们将集中讨论“Python3 遍历时间”的相关问题,涵盖版本对比、迁移指南、兼容性处理、实战案例、性能优化以及生态扩展等多个方面。希望这些信息对需要处理时间数据的开发者们有所帮助。
### 版本对比
Python 的时间模块在不同版本中不断演进,新增的特性和函数,使得遍历时间更加便捷。
**时间轴**
```mermaid
timeline
title Python
# Python遍历时间段的实现教学
在数据处理与分析的领域,我们常常会遇到需要遍历时间段的情况。比如,我们可能需要生成一个特定时间段内的所有日期,或者对每个日期执行某种操作。本文将指导你完成这个任务,帮助你更好地理解如何在Python中处理时间。
## 流程概览
在实现“python遍历时间段”的过程中,我们将遵循以下步骤:
| 步骤 | 说明
原创
2024-08-15 04:57:23
57阅读
# MySQL遍历时间范围
在实际的数据库操作中,我们经常需要查询一段时间范围内的数据。MySQL数据库提供了多种方法来遍历时间范围,并获取所需数据。本文将介绍使用MySQL查询语句和函数来实现时间范围遍历的方法,并给出相关的代码示例。
## 1. 使用BETWEEN和AND操作符
MySQL提供了BETWEEN和AND操作符来查询指定范围内的数据。这两个操作符可以与日期和时间类型的列一起使
原创
2023-10-27 06:29:22
59阅读
## Python遍历时修改数据的方式
在Python中,遍历集合或序列时有时需要修改其中的元素。然而,直接在遍历过程中修改数据可能会导致意外的结果或错误。本文将介绍一些常见的方法来解决这个问题,并提供相应的代码示例。
### 为什么不能直接在遍历过程中修改数据?
在很多编程语言中,直接在遍历过程中修改数据是一个危险的行为。这是因为在遍历过程中,迭代器或指针指向当前元素,如果修改当前元素,可
原创
2023-07-22 18:16:26
1718阅读
# Java遍历时间段
在Java中,我们经常需要处理时间段的操作,例如计算两个时间点之间的时间差,判断某个时间是否在给定的时间段内等等。本文将介绍如何在Java中遍历时间段,并提供代码示例。
## 1. Java中的时间表示
在Java中,时间可以使用`java.util.Date`类来表示。`Date`类使用一个64位的long值来存储时间,表示自1970年1月1日00:00:00 GM
原创
2023-11-16 11:55:58
163阅读
# 如何在Java中使用for循环遍历时间区间
作为一名经验丰富的开发者,我将帮助你学会如何在Java中使用for循环来遍历时间区间。首先,让我们来看整个流程:
## 流程图
```mermaid
pie
title Time Interval Loop
"定义起始时间" : 20
"定义结束时间" : 20
"使用for循环遍历" : 60
```
## 步骤
原创
2024-06-22 06:26:26
147阅读
# MySQL存储过程遍历时间的使用探索
在数据库开发与管理中,往往需要对时间和日期数据进行各种操作。尤其是在项目管理系统、任务调度系统中,时间的处理显得尤为重要。本文将介绍如何在MySQL中通过存储过程来遍历时间,提供相关的代码示例,并利用甘特图展现任务的时间安排。
## 什么是存储过程
存储过程是数据库中一组预编译的 SQL 语句和可选的控制流逻辑,存储在数据库中。存储过程可以接收参数,
原创
2024-09-22 05:20:46
49阅读
# Python Set 遍历时删除元素的流程
在 Python 中,集合(set)是一种无序的元素集合,能够快速地进行成员测试、去重等操作。然而,如果在遍历集合的时候直接删除元素,可能会导致意想不到的错误。因此,我们需要采取一种安全的方式来处理这一问题。在这篇文章中,我将指导你如何在遍历集合时安全地删除元素。
## 整体流程
下面是处理这一问题的整体流程:
| 步骤 | 描述
原创
2024-10-27 04:53:24
48阅读
# Python字典遍历时删除元素的正确方法
在Python中,字典是一种重要的数据结构,它以键值对的形式存储数据。字典的灵活性和高效性使其在处理各种数据时都非常有用。然而,当我们在遍历字典时,如果想要删除某个元素,直接在循环中删除会导致运行错误。本文将介绍如何在遍历字典时安全地删除元素,并提供相应的代码示例。
## 为何不能在遍历时直接删除元素
当你在遍历一个字典时,如果尝试在循环体内直接
# Python遍历时间范围内的日期
## 流程图
```mermaid
flowchart TD
A[开始] --> B{导入datetime模块}
B --> C{定义起始日期和结束日期}
C --> D{遍历日期范围}
D --> E[输出日期]
E --> F[结束]
```
## 整体流程
首先,我们需要导入`datetime`模块,然后定
原创
2024-05-08 04:29:57
103阅读
# Python字典遍历时删除的实现方法
## 引言
在Python开发中,字典是一种非常常用的数据结构,它用于存储键值对的集合。有时候我们需要在遍历字典的过程中删除一些键值对,但是直接在循环中删除会导致迭代错误。本文将介绍如何正确地在遍历字典时删除键值对的方法。
## 解决方案概述
为了解决这个问题,我们需要采取一种安全的方法来删除字典中的键值对。一种常用的方法是创建一个待删除的键列表,在遍
原创
2023-09-22 02:50:25
156阅读
# Java循环遍历时间查询数据实现方法
## 1. 概述
本文将介绍如何使用Java编程语言实现循环遍历时间查询数据的方法。这个问题通常出现在需要对一个时间范围内的数据进行批量查询和处理的场景中。通过阅读本文,你将了解到整个实现过程的流程,并掌握每一步所需的代码和操作。
## 2. 流程
下面是实现“Java循环遍历时间查询数据”的流程图:
```mermaid
stateDiagra
原创
2024-01-25 04:19:03
96阅读
# Java List 遍历优化指南
在今天的文章中,我们将一起探索如何在Java中高效地遍历List集合。Java中有多种遍历List的方式,但我们希望找到时间效率最高的方法。接下来,我们将通过一个明确的流程来展示这些方法,并给出相应的代码示例和注释。
## 遍历流程概览
| 步骤 | 方法 | 描述
原创
2024-08-01 09:00:50
33阅读
1. 阐述 对于Java中Map的遍历方式,很多文章都推荐使用entrySet,认为其比keySet的效率高很多。理由是:entrySet方法一次拿到所有key和value的集合;而keySet拿到的只是key的集合,针对每个key,都要去Map中额外查找一次value,从而降低了总体效率。那么实际情况如何呢? 为了解遍历性能的真实差距,包括在遍历key+value、遍历key、遍历value
转载
2023-08-29 17:40:01
74阅读
# Python字典遍历时删除元素
在Python编程中,字典(dictionary)是一种非常有用的数据类型。它以键值对(key-value pair)的形式存储数据,其中每个键(key)都是唯一的。字典可以用于存储大量数据,并且可以根据键快速查找对应的值。然而,在对字典进行遍历的过程中,我们需要注意一些问题,尤其是在删除元素时。
## 字典遍历
在Python中,我们可以使用多种方式遍历
原创
2023-07-25 18:57:21
1182阅读
# Python字典遍历与删除元素的教程
在进行Python字典操作时,我们常常需要在遍历字典的同时删除一些元素。然而,直接在遍历字典时删除元素会导致运行时错误。因此,了解如何安全地在遍历时删除字典中的元素至关重要。本文将详细介绍实现这一目标的流程,提供相应的代码示例,并解释每一步骤的具体实现。
## 流程
下面是处理字典遍历与删除的基本步骤:
| 步骤 | 描述
# Python 列表遍历时删除元素
在Python中,我们经常需要对列表进行操作,包括遍历元素以及根据某些条件删除元素。然而,在遍历列表的同时删除元素可能会导致一些意想不到的结果。本文将介绍如何在遍历列表时安全地删除元素,并给出代码示例。
## 列表遍历和删除
### 常见问题
当我们在使用常规的`for`循环遍历列表时,如果直接使用`remove()`或`del`来删除元素,可能会导致
# jQuery如何让遍历时间间隔加大
在开发中,有时候需要对一组元素进行遍历操作,并在遍历过程中加入时间间隔,以达到延迟执行的效果。这种情况下,我们可以利用jQuery的`each`方法和`setTimeout`函数来实现。
## 1. jQuery的each方法
jQuery的`each`方法用于遍历一个jQuery对象中的所有元素,并对每个元素执行指定的函数。它的基本语法如下:
``
原创
2024-02-13 03:58:56
33阅读